Program Overview
Computer Science - BSc (Hons)
The Computer Science program at Toronto Metropolitan University helps students turn theoretical knowledge into cutting-edge applications, unlocking the power of science and technology to transform the digital world. This program covers various aspects of computer science, including coding, AI, cybersecurity, and more.
Program Details
- Degree: Bachelor of Science (Honours)
- Full-time formats: 4 Year, 5-Year Co-op
- Part-time format: First-Year Entry
- Requirements: Grades-Only
- Grade range: Low 80s
- Faculty: Faculty of Science
- Experiential learning: Co-op available
Is this degree for you?
This program is designed for students who want to apply theoretical knowledge to real-world problems in computer science. It offers experiential learning opportunities, including optional paid co-op positions, labs, and research opportunities.
Concentration and Specialization
- Concentration: Software Engineering
- Optional specialization: Management Sciences
First-Year Courses
The following is a preview of first-year courses:
1st Semester
- REQUIRED:
- CPS 109 Computer Science I or CPS 106 Introduction to Multimedia Computation
- CPS 213 Computer Organization I
- MTH 110 Discrete Mathematics I
- REQUIRED GROUP 1: One course from the following:
- BLG 143 Biology I
- CHY 103 General Chemistry I
- PCS 110 Physics
- LIBERAL STUDIES: One course from Table A - Lower Level Liberal Studies.
2nd Semester
- REQUIRED:
- CPS 209 Computer Science II
- CPS 310 Computer Organization II
- CPS 412 Social Issues, Ethics and Professionalism
- MTH 207 Calculus and Computational Methods I
- LIBERAL STUDIES: One course from Table A - Lower Level Liberal Studies.
Career Possibilities
- Cloud systems engineer
- Cybersecurity specialist
- Data scientist
- Full-stack developer
- UX engineer
Employer Possibilities
- Amazon
- Apple
- CBC
- Wealthsimple
Further Education
- Computer Science (MSc)
- Data Science and Analytics (MSc)
- Law
Requirements
This is a Grades-Only program. Admission decisions for Grades-Only programs are based on academic performance.
Academic Requirements for Full-time, 4-year Program
To be considered for admission, Ontario high school students must meet the following requirements:
- Completion of the Ontario Secondary School Diploma (OSSD)
- Completion of 6 Grade 12 U or M courses with a minimum overall average of 70%
- Completion of the following required Grade 12 U courses (minimum grade of 70% in each):
- English/anglais (ENG4U/EAE4U preferred)
- Advanced Functions (MHF4U)
- One of Calculus and Vectors (MCV4U) (preferred) or Mathematics of Data Management (MDM4U)
- One of Physics (SPH4U), Chemistry (SCH4U), Biology (SBI4U)
An overall average of 70% is required for consideration. Due to competition, the average needed for admission can fluctuate each year.
Academic Requirements for Part-time Program
Part-time: First-year Entry
Applicants for admission to the part-time, 40-course degree program must meet the following requirements:
- Completion of the Ontario Secondary School Diploma (OSSD)
- Completion of 6 Grade 12 U or M courses with a minimum overall average of 70%
- Completion of the following required Grade 12 U courses (minimum grade of 70% in each):
- English/anglais (ENG4U/EAE4U preferred)
- Advanced Functions (MHF4U)
- One of Calculus and Vectors (MCV4U) (preferred) or Mathematics of Data Management (MDM4U)
- One of Physics (SPH4U), Chemistry (SCH4U), Biology (SBI4U)
Fees and Funding
Tuition and Fees Range
- Full-time format:
- Ontario: $7,284 - $9,796
- Out-of-province: $8,823 - $11,954
- International: $36,815 - $36,875
- Part-time format:
- Ontario: $1,250 - $7,389
- Out-of-province: $1,466 - $9,115
- International: $3,879 - $28,419
Faculty of Science
The Faculty of Science at Toronto Metropolitan University offers a range of undergraduate programs, including the Computer Science program. The faculty is committed to providing students with a comprehensive education in science, with a focus on practical learning and experiential opportunities.
